Justin Smith: “If I’m fortunate enough, I’ll get to play in this one.”

SANTA CLARA – Justin Smith practiced Thursday for the first time since he tore his left triceps tendon in New England on December 16th.

He spoke at his locker after practice, and this is what he said.

Q: How did your injured elbow feel in practice today?

JUSTIN SMITH: We didn’t really do nothing, so it felt alright.

Q: Do you think the bye week will help you play in the playoffs?

JUSTIN SMITH: It couldn’t hurt any. It is what it is. We’ll see how it is and go from there.

Q: Did you have to make any adjustments?

JUSTIN SMITH: It felt good for today. We’ll go out there and see what happens.

Q: Are you worried about reinjuring it?

JUSTIN SMITH: We really haven’t played or done anything yet. Hopefully they run right at me and we find out quick.

Q: What’s it been like being on the sideline watching these games?

JUSTIN SMITH: It is what it is. You go from there. If I’m fortunate enough, I’ll get to play in this one. We’ll see what happens.

Q: Is it more a matter of strength or pain?

JUSTIN SMITH: I think it’s just a matter of getting out there and going. You just go out there and play until you can’t and be ready. I feel like I’ll be ready.
